RAWALPINDI: The Indian Army in yet another incident of ceasefire violation resorted to unprovoked firing along Line of Control (LoC), injuring four Pakistani civilians, including a child.
According to Inter-Services Public Relations (ISPR) statement, Indian troops resorted to the unprovoked fire of heavy weapons including mortars along LOC in Lepa valley deliberately targeting the civilian population.
ISPR said that 4 civilians including 2 women and a child sustained injuries.
Earlier this month, unprovoked shelling from the Indian side at the Satwal sector at the LoC injured one Pakistani.
